美文网首页
在拦截器中配置跨域

在拦截器中配置跨域

作者: embers1996 | 来源:发表于2019-04-14 14:55 被阅读0次

在前后端分离开发的时候会存在跨域的问题,假如采用拦截器进行缓存命中,实现的拦截器中并没有对跨域进行支持,需要对CORS跨域支持:


image.png
   // 将data数据进行响应
        response.setCharacterEncoding("UTF-8");
        response.setContentType("application/json; charset=utf-8");

        // 支持跨域
        response.setHeader("Access-Control-Allow-Origin", "*");
        response.setHeader("Access-Control-Allow-Methods", "GET,POST,PUT,DELETE,OPTIONS");
        response.setHeader("Access-Control-Allow-Credentials", "true");
        response.setHeader("Access-Control-Allow-Headers", "Content-Type,X-Token");
        response.setHeader("Access-Control-Allow-Credentials", "true");

相关文章

  • 拦截器的配置以及解决跨域问题

    本章介绍拦截器和过滤器的区别,如何配置拦截器Interceptor以及在拦截器中解决跨域问题项目源码:https:...

  • spring-boot 允许接口跨域并实现拦截(CORS)

    pom.xml(依赖的jar) CORS跨域的配置(主要配置允许什么样的方法跨域) 拦截器配置(可以根据不同路径,...

  • springboot 允许跨域

    设置跨域拦截器 在拦截器包下创建跨域拦截器 注册拦截器 全局使用 项目结构在这里插入图片描述

  • 在拦截器中配置跨域

    在前后端分离开发的时候会存在跨域的问题,假如采用拦截器进行缓存命中,实现的拦截器中并没有对跨域进行支持,需要对CO...

  • axios 跨越配置代理后 post 405 get正常

    跨域配置如下: 之后请求,发现post请求报405错误,get请求正常,原因: 笔者项目web.xml中配置拦截器...

  • Springboot跨域拦截器顺序问题小坑

    SpringBoot使用自带拦截器配置跨域会有问题。当你自定义的权限拦截器抛出异常的时候,自定义的拦截器比自带的跨...

  • javaweb 中的跨域请求

    方法一 、使用ajax进行跨域请求 方法json数据 配置拦截器用于允许指定的请求跨域 为含有/json/的url...

  • 浏览器跨域的那些事

    整理中 目标: 了解跨域 解决跨域 服务器配置跨域(java, nginx) 前端调试时配置解决跨域 一、什么是跨...

  • Express 解决跨域请求

    在app.js中配置跨域请求

  • Java跨域问题

    前端请求跨域问题,可以在后端拦截器中配置如下代码: 此处为什么需要放行OPTIONS请求,因为前端浏览器在发现存在...

网友评论

      本文标题:在拦截器中配置跨域

      本文链接:https://www.haomeiwen.com/subject/jctswqtx.html